Course overview

The ICTQual Level 1 Award in Bird Watching Techniques is an introductory qualification designed to help learners explore the basics of bird identification and field observation within the field of Ornithology. It provides a strong foundation for understanding common bird species, their characteristics, and natural behaviors in different habitats.

This course focuses on developing practical bird watching skills, including the use of basic observation tools, recording sightings, and recognizing bird calls and movements. Learners are also introduced to essential field techniques that support accurate identification and data collection in outdoor environments.

Ideal for beginners, nature enthusiasts, and students interested in wildlife, this qualification also promotes awareness of environmental conservation and the importance of protecting bird habitats. It serves as a stepping stone for further studies in wildlife, ecology, and environmental sciences.

What you will Gain

Learning Outcomes for the ICTQual Level 1 Award in Bird Watching Techniques:

Introduction to Bird Identification

  • Recognize common bird species using visual features such as plumage, size, and shape.
  • Identify birds by behaviour and movement patterns in natural habitats.
  • Distinguish species through calls and songs using basic auditory recognition skills.
  • Apply simple field techniques to improve accuracy in bird identification.

Fundamentals of Bird Watching Equipment

  • Use binoculars effectively for clear and safe bird observation.
  • Select appropriate equipment such as notebooks, field guides, and cameras for bird watching.
  • Maintain and care for equipment to ensure reliability during fieldwork.
  • Apply ethical practices when using equipment to avoid disturbing birds and habitats.

Recording and Reporting Observations

  • Record bird sightings accurately using notes, sketches, or digital tools.
  • Organize observation data into simple formats for personal or group use.
  • Report findings responsibly to local bird watching groups or conservation initiatives.
  • Reflect on observations to improve identification skills and ecological awareness.
